Address

RwcdQ9VbT4ojf66yp9GHCR67BtBqvH7X8iCopy

Total Received

268341160.60115191 RDD

Total Sent

268341160.60115191 RDD

№ Transactions

100

Final Balance

0 RDD

Transactions
Filter